  • Publication number: 20230050715
    Abstract: A transcranial magnetic stimulation (TMS) treatment system is provided. The system includes a sensor device that senses EEG signals from a subject through one or more leads and a server device configured to receive EEG data corresponding to the subject. The server includes an analysis module configured to process the EEG data and determine a personalized resonant brain frequency and a minimum neuronal activation threshold of the subject based at least in part on EEG data corresponding to one or more leads of the sensor device. The analysis module is also configured to determine a TMS treatment protocol where the treatment protocol includes at least a frequency based on the personalized resonant brain frequency and an amplitude based on the minimum neuronal activation threshold. The system also includes a treatment device configured to deliver a TMS treatment to the subject based on the TMS treatment protocol received from the server.

  • Publication number: 20110169755
    Abstract: Various embodiments of computer systems, methods, and computer programs are disclosed for implementing an integrated vehicle entertainment/navigation (IVEN) computer system. One embodiment is an integrated vehicle entertainment and navigation system comprising a central computer, a primary display device, a first secondary display device, a second secondary display device, and a multi-zone configuration module. The central computer is powered by a power source of a vehicle, and comprises a processor and a memory. The primary display device is located in a first zone in the vehicle and is in communication with the central computer. The first secondary display device is located in a second zone in the vehicle and the second secondary display device is located in a third zone in the vehicle. The first and second secondary display devices are in communication with the central computer via a multi-zone hub.
